Step 4: Calculate how many solar panels you need. Finally, you can divide the system size by the power output of a solar panel to find out how many solar panels you need. The higher a solar panel’s power output, the fewer panels you need to install. In this article, we’ll look at five different ...Keep checking the voltage of your battery until it reaches about 12.2 volts. You could use a multimeter for this if your RV panel doesn’t already display voltage. At 12.2 volts, your battery is about 50% discharged. To define a range, consider low-wattage (150 W) and high-wattage (370 W) examples (for example, 17-42 panels to …Solar panels needed = 10,800 kW / 1.5 / 320W. Using these numbers means we would need 22.5 solar panels. But since you can’t chop a solar panel in half we would either need 23 panels or could reduce the number of panels we need by using a higher wattage panel.
